How they compare

Philippines currently reports 9.53 million kg against 8.82 million kg in Paraguay, a difference of 713,360 kg.

That makes Philippines's figure about 1.1 times Paraguay's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 63 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Paraguay ahead.

Paraguay ranks 44th and Philippines ranks 43rd of 163 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Paraguay averaged higher in 6 and Philippines in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Paraguay Philippines Difference Ahead
1960s 14.91 million kg 9.33 million kg 5.58 million kg Paraguay
1970s 12.88 million kg 8.61 million kg 4.27 million kg Paraguay
1980s 12.56 million kg 7.62 million kg 4.94 million kg Paraguay
1990s 13.91 million kg 8.28 million kg 5.63 million kg Paraguay
2000s 12.92 million kg 8.80 million kg 4.12 million kg Paraguay
2010s 10.39 million kg 9.20 million kg 1.19 million kg Paraguay
2020s 8.82 million kg 9.48 million kg 661,402 kg Philippines

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The Livestock Manure domain of FAOSTAT contains estimates of nitrogen (N) inputs to agricultural soils from livestock manure. Data on the N losses to air and water are also disseminated. These estimates are compiled using official FAOSTAT statistics of animal stocks and by applying the internationally approved Guidelines of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C). Data are available by country, with global coverage and updated annually.The following elements are disseminated: 1) Stocks; 2) Amount excreted in manure (N content); 3) Manure left on pasture (N content); 4) Manure left on pasture that volatilises (N content); 5) Manure left on pasture that leaches (N content); 6) Manure treated (N content); 7) Losses from manure treated (N content); 8) Manure applied to soils (N content); 9) Manure applied to soils that volatilises (N content); 10) Manure applied to soils that leaches (N content).
